Early Literacy Book Distribution

The Early Literacy Book Distribution program provides children’s books for families receiving services in the Children’s Services Council of Palm Beach County’s Healthy Beginnings system of early childhood care. The dedicated doctors, staff, and healthcare facilities who support this program and their commitment to placing books in the hands of young children and their families play a vital role in building a strong literacy foundation for young children, while encouraging and fostering a lifelong love of reading in our community.

Every baby born in a Palm Beach County hospital receives a book to take home to start their home library.

By The Numbers

39,434

books were distributed to Healthy Beginnings programs.

19

Healthy Beginnings programs throughout Palm Beach County

11

Healthy Beginnings program providers

Success Story

“We are very appreciative of the Early Literacy Book Distribution program. It allows the Counseling for Parents and Young Children program, the Prenatal Plus Mental Health Program as well as the Positive Parenting Program (Triple P) at Center for Family Services (CFS) to provide our children, teenagers, and parents with great reading materials. Through this incredible partnership, we are able to provide a variety of books that pertain to social emotional learning and mental health, so that our participating families may further their journey of growing, learning, and improving their mental health. The books allow for wonderful bonding time between children and their caregivers while exploring the literary world. We also are able to provide books for adult caregivers, helping sustain them in caring for themselves so they can be the best possible support they can be for their children.”
–Todd L’Herrou, CEO at Center for Family Services of Palm Beach County, Inc.
